Nordertor: A Gateway to Flensburg's History

Nordertor, the iconic gate of Flensburg, stands as a testament to the city's storied past and architectural beauty. Erected in 1595, this historical landmark once served as a vital entry point into the city, symbolizing both protection and prosperity during the height of Flensburg's maritime trade. As you approach Nordertor, you will be captivated by its impressive brick façade and intricate detailing that reflect the craftsmanship of the era. The structure's towering presence invites you to explore the vibrant history that surrounds it. Beyond its aesthetic appeal, Nordertor is a nod to the rich tapestry of Flensburg's past. The gate has witnessed centuries of change, from medieval skirmishes to modern-day cultural festivals. Today, it serves as a popular meeting point for locals and tourists alike, making it an ideal spot for photography and leisurely strolls. The surrounding area is brimming with quaint shops, cafés, and museums,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in the city’s charm.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, take the A7 highway towards Flensburg. Exit at 'Flensburg' and follow the B200 towards the city center. Once you reach the city center, follow signs to Norderstraße. Nordertor is located at Norderstraße 138, 24939 Flensburg. There is on-street parking available nearby, but be mindful of parking regulations.

  • Train

    If you are using public transportation, take a train to Flensburg from various locations in North Frisia. Once you arrive at Flensburg Hauptbahnhof (main station), exit the station and head towards the bus station. Take bus line 1, 2, or 5 towards 'Zentrum' and get off at the 'Zentrum' stop. From there, it's a short 10-minute walk to Nordertor, located at Norderstraße 138. Follow Norderstraße north until you reach your destination.

  • Bus

    For those opting for buses, you can take regional buses to Flensburg from nearby towns such as Glücksburg or Harrislee. Alight at Flensburg central bus station. From there, take bus line 1, 2, or 5 towards 'Zentrum'. Disembark at 'Zentrum' and walk north along Norderstraße for about 10 minutes to reach Nordertor at Norderstraße 138.

  • Walking

    If you are already within walking distance in Flensburg, simply head to Norderstraße. Nordertor is located at Norderstraße 138. It is easily accessible by foot from the city center and is about a 15-minute walk from the Flensburg Hauptbahnhof.
